Codrus, according to legend, was a king of Athens during a tumultuous period marked by foreign invasions. His story is not just one of kingship but is steeped in themes of patriotism and selflessness. Notably, Codrus is remembered for the pivotal role he played in sacrificing himself for the greater good of his city-state.
